Description:
Benzeneethanamine, 4-(3-methylbutoxy)-, hydrochloride (1:1), also known by its CAS number 1201633-54-6, is a chemical compound characterized by its amine functional group and aromatic benzene ring. This substance features a 4-substituted benzeneethanamine structure, where a 3-methylbutoxy group is attached to the benzene ring, contributing to its hydrophobic properties. The hydrochloride form indicates that it is a salt formed with hydrochloric acid, enhancing its solubility in water and making it suitable for various applications, particularly in pharmaceuticals. The presence of the amine group suggests potential basicity and reactivity, allowing for interactions with acids and other electrophiles. Its molecular structure may influence its biological activity, making it of interest in medicinal chemistry. Formula:C13H21NO·ClH
InChI:InChI=1S/C13H21NO.ClH/c1-11(2)8-10-15-13-5-3-12(4-6-13)7-9-14;/h3-6,11H,7-10,14H2,1-2H3;1H
InChI key:InChIKey=QRTMYRQYOQNTLI-UHFFFAOYSA-N
SMILES:O(CCC(C)C)C1=CC=C(CCN)C=C1.Cl
